MIAMI, May 21, 2026 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Laureate Education, Inc. (NASDAQ: LAUR), which operates five higher education institutions across Mexico and Peru, today announced the election of Julian Coulter as an independent member of the Laureate Education, Inc. Board of Directors at today’s 2026 Annual Meeting of Stockholders.

Mr. Coulter is the Global Managing Director, Food, Beverage & Restaurants at Google, Inc., a global technology company, and previously held various leadership positions at Google from 2018 to 2025 in Mexico and Peru. Prior to Google, Mr. Coulter held several other international digital strategy and commercial operations leadership positions, including at Sony Corporation and SABMiller. From 2019 to 2025, Mr. Coulter served as a Board Member of Delosi, S.A., an operator of international restaurant franchises including Starbucks and Burger King. Mr. Coulter earned a B.A. in Economics from Trinity College Dublin and an M.B.A. from Harvard Business School.

As previously planned, Kenneth W. Freeman and Dr. Judith Rodin did not stand for re-election as directors at the 2026 Annual Meeting of Stockholders.

Following these changes, Laureate's Board is comprised of nine directors, eight of whom are independent. About Laureate Education, Inc.

Laureate Education, Inc. operates five higher education institutions across Mexico and Peru, enrolling approximately 500,000 students in high-quality undergraduate, graduate, and specialized degree programs through campus-based and online learning. Our universities have a deep commitment to academic quality and innovation, strive for market-leading employability outcomes, and work to make higher education more accessible.
